Actually Evo's are pretty common in the States. Though people around here don't seem to care, and know about these cars. :indiff:

Tip diameter? 4"- 5" sounds good, anything less looks a little small for an R32 IMO. Getting an exhaust that has a resonator should give the deep, droning sound. My dad's VI TME has an RSR catback, test pipe + downpipe and the idle sounds super deep. Mine is basically 3 inch metal pipes all the way with a 5" tip. I'm pretty sure it's 5", either way it's big enough to stuff my arm down to my elbow. :lol: But since it doesn't have any resonators the sound is not as deep.



The older USDM Evo's ('03-'04) didn't come with ACD but this is what it does: http://www.lancerevoclub.com/evoclub-acd-e.htm

Oh and no I haven't made it to the tracks yet, it should be able to do low 12's - high 11's. 👍
